What's Happening?
Washington Technology has announced an extension for the nomination deadline of its 2025 Fast 50 program, which ranks small businesses based on their compound annual growth rates over a five-year period. The new deadline is set for September 5, 2025. The program evaluates government revenue from 2020 to 2024, requiring a minimum of $100,000 in government revenue for 2020 to qualify. The Fast 50 rankings will be published on October 10, 2025, and will include detailed revenue data and business information such as capabilities, major customers, and contracts. This extension provides additional time for small businesses to apply and potentially gain recognition for their growth and achievements.
